Что такое API и как действует взаимосвязь служб
API составляет собой набор требований, которые позволяют системам обмениваться данными между собой. Аббревиатура трактуется как Application Programming Interface, что переводится как программный интерфейс программы. Технология является связующим между программными элементами.
Связь систем через Покердом реализуется по принципу запроса и реакции. Одна система передаёт обращение, а другая обрабатывает информацию и отдаёт ответ. Процесс похож разговор, только участниками выступают софтверные платформы.
Актуальные виртуальные сервисы регулярно передают данными для выполнения заданий клиентов. Программный механизм преобразует такой передачу единообразным и предсказуемым.
Технология решает задачу интеграции разных сред. Разработчики разрабатывают решения на разных языках разработки, но благодаря Pokerdom эти системы эффективно работают независимо от собственной устройства.
Понятие API и его место в нынешних технологиях
Софтверный интерфейс программы функционирует как протокол между софтверными приложениями. Контракт устанавливает формат требований, схему данных и требования извлечения ответов. Программисты задействуют спецификацию для освоения доступных функций.
Технология играет важнейшую место в виртуальной инфраструктуре. Банковские платформы, социальные сети и расчётные службы работают через Покердом официальный сайт для обеспечения комплексных продуктов. Без такого связи каждому системе пришлось бы разрабатывать функциональность отдельно.
Механизмы дают организациям наращивать опции решений без роста штата. Компания может внедрить существующие решения для оплаты или определения вместо формирования этих компонентов. Способ экономит период и затраты.
Нынешняя экономика программ базируется на многократном возможностей. Программный интерфейс гарантирует стандартизированный вход к функциям сервиса и ускоряет построение цифровых приложений.
Механизм взаимодействия информацией между сервисами
Коммуникация данными между системами происходит через структурированные запросы. Клиентское решение составляет требование с аргументами и отправляет его серверу. Сервер анализирует данные, совершает операции и отправляет реакцию назад.
Информация передаются в стандартизированных структурах, чаще всего JSON или XML. Шаблоны гарантируют единообразие структуры и облегчают анализ разными системами. Клиент и хост понимают архитектуру благодаря согласованным требованиям.
Каждый обращение имеет вид манипуляции, расположение элемента и параметры действия. Способы определяют категорию операции: приём сведений, формирование записи, обновление или устранение элемента. Программный интерфейс через Покердом обрабатывает требования соответственно указанным правилам.
Отклик системы содержит идентификатор статуса и сведения ответа. Шифр информирует об успешности действия или сбоях. Данные несут затребованную данные в установленном формате. Механизм работает независимо от основы сервисов.
Иллюстрации API в будничной жизни пользователей
Программные инструменты присутствуют юзеров в будничных компьютерных действиях. Немало привычные манипуляции действуют благодаря обмену данными между системами. Технология продолжает незаметной, но даёт лёгкость работы сервисов.
Частые примеры применения механизмов в повседневной реальности:
- Идентификация через социальные ресурсы использует средства Facebook или Google для верификации человека
- Внедрённые карты в программах такси получают данные о трассах через Pokerdom картографических сервисов
- Электронная продуктов выполняется через интерфейсы финансовых платформ, проводящих операции
- Прогноз климата скачивается с метеорологических серверов через целевые инструменты
- Публикация снимков в несколько социальных платформ реализуется через софтверные инструменты каждой сети
Пользователи работают с десятками инструментов регулярно, не догадываясь об этом. Технология превращает виртуальный взаимодействие цельным и приятным.
Как API ускоряет внедрение разнообразных систем
Подключение без софтверных интерфейсов предполагала бы освоения внутренней структуры любой решения. Специалистам пришлось бы осознавать структуру хранилищ информации и принципы анализа внешнего продукта. Такой способ поглощал бы месяцы и формировал риски безопасности.
Программный механизм выдаёт готовый совокупность функций для коммуникации. Специалист осваивает документацию и начинает задействовать функции партнёрского решения через Покердом официальный сайт за несколько суток. Собственное структура платформы является скрытым и безопасным.
Единообразие шаблонов передачи ликвидирует требование построения индивидуальных систем для каждого клиента. Компания строит общий механизм, который задействуют сотни заказчиков. Подход снижает затраты на поддержку интеграций.
Модульная архитектура обеспечивает заменять компоненты без изменения решения. Компания может поменять партнёра финансовых операций, внедрив иной механизм. Гибкость ускоряет приспособление компании к изменениям сектора.
Обращения и реакции: фундаментальная схема работы API
Схема взаимодействия строится на механизме запрос-ответ между пользователем и узлом. Клиентское программа инициирует коммуникацию, отправляя требование с указанием запрашиваемого манипуляции. Сервер анализирует запрос и составляет ответ с исходом манипуляции.
Требование содержит множество требуемых модулей. Способ указывает категорию процедуры: извлечение, генерацию, корректировку или удаление информации. Адрес определяет конкретный ресурс на сервере. Хедеры содержат дополнительную о структуре и настройках проверки. Тело обращения направляет информацию для выполнения.
Результат системы включает из кода статуса и данных исхода. Коды сообщают об удаче или категории неполадки. Успешные действия выдают шифры группы 200, ошибки пользователя — группы 400, неполадки системы — диапазона 500. Софтверный механизм через сайт покердом предоставляет понятную коммуникацию между системами.
Информация реакции содержат желаемую данные в форматированном шаблоне. Приложение парсит полученные информацию и эксплуатирует их для представления юзеру или дальнейшей обработки.
Защита и проверка при эксплуатации API
Сохранность данных при коммуникации между решениями потребует разноуровневых средств сохранности. Софтверные средства транслируют секретную информацию, включая личные информацию юзеров. Отсутствие сохранности порождает угрозы разглашения и неавторизованного проникновения.
Аутентификация верифицирует личность пользователя перед выдачей доступа к объектам. Системы эксплуатируют маркеры авторизации или идентификаторы для распознавания обращающейся стороны. Токен передаётся с каждым запросом и подтверждает возможность на выполнение процедуры через Pokerdom зашифрованного подключения.
Шифрование данных оберегает сведения при передаче по соединению. Стандарт HTTPS гарантирует криптованное соединение между клиентом и узлом. Перехват трафика не обеспечивает увидеть содержимое запросов и ответов.
Лимитирование количества обращений блокирует атаки и избыточность систем. Платформы задают пороги на численность обращений за интервал. Нарушение ограничения закрывает подключение или нуждается дополнительной идентификации.
Публичные и закрытые API: различия и использование
Программные механизмы классифицируются на открытые и закрытые в связи от намеченной аудитории. Публичные интерфейсы открыты для независимых инженеров. Приватные используются в фирмы для коммуникации корпоративных приложений.
Публичные интерфейсы предоставляют вход к функциональности обширному спектру пользователей. Предприятия публикуют спецификацию и распределяют ключи доступа. Модель развивает платформу продукта через Покердом публичных возможностей объединения.
Главные разница между типами средств:
- Публичные предполагают детальной документации и инженерной помощи для независимых разработчиков
- Приватные эксплуатируются внутренними группами и несут упрощённую руководство
- Публичные подвергаются строгий проверку безопасности из-за публичного подключения
- Приватные обеспечивают связь микросервисов внутри внутренней системы
Определение типа определяется от корпоративной компании. Общедоступные поощряют увеличение среды, закрытые совершенствуют корпоративные процессы.
Роль API в создании инфраструктур виртуальных сервисов
Инфраструктура электронных продуктов представляет собой структуру интегрированных систем, обогащающих функции друг друга. Софтверные механизмы являются объединяющим компонентом между элементами. Технология обеспечивает отдельным решениям работать как общее единство.
Ведущие технологические компании развивают инфраструктуры на базовых продуктов. Разработчики формируют приложения, усиливающие инструменты ключевого решения через Покердом официальный сайт открытых интерфейсов. Клиенты получают соединение к массе расширенных опций без изменения решения.
Коллаборационные интеграции повышают ценность сервисов для пользователей. Платформа резервирования отелей соединяется с авиакомпаниями и системами расчётов. Клиент составляет поездку в общем приложении благодаря связи массы решений.
Публичные механизмы стимулируют улучшения и привлекают инженеров к созданию решений. Предприятие сосредотачивается на ключевой опциях, а союзники включают специализированные функции. Концепция форсирует рост решения и увеличивает лояльность пользователей.
Значение API на темп построения дополнительных опций
Скорость вывода решения на рынок определяет конкурентоспособность предприятия в цифровой сфере. Софтверные средства снижают период создания за помощь подготовленных инструментов. Группа концентрируется на оригинальной функциональности взамен формирования основных модулей.
Внедрение партнёрских служб экономит месяцы труда программистов. Подключение платформы расчётов или позиционирования требует дни вместо недель автономной разработки. Софтверный механизм через Pokerdom предоставляет надёжную функциональность, готовую к задействованию.
Блочная архитектура позволяет коллективам трудиться синхронно над различными элементами системы. Инженеры строят независимые компоненты с персональными инструментами. Элементы объединяются в завершённый систему без конфликтов.
Многократное применение алгоритмов форсирует построение новых релизов приложений. Организация формирует собственные интерфейсы для общих функций: аутентификации, сообщений, сохранения данных. Свежие задачи используют подготовленные блоки. Метод сокращает численность дефектов и упрощает сопровождение.